About

Dr. Angelo Goglia is a surgical oncologist whose research focuses on refining complex oncologic surgical techniques and understanding their long-term outcomes, particularly in gastrointestinal and gynecologic malignancies. His work addresses critical challenges in surgical oncology, including the prevention of cancer recurrence after minimally invasive procedures. Dr. Goglia’s most cited study, “Trocar Site Recurrences Following Laparoscopic and Robotic Resection of Gynecologic Malignancies” (2017, 6 citations), provides a vital analysis of a rare but serious complication, helping surgeons understand risk factors and improve patient safety in robotic and laparoscopic surgery. Further demonstrating his commitment to surgical innovation, his paper “Advantages of the Maneuver of Intestinal Derotation for Pancreaticoduodenectomy” (2016, 4 citations) explores a technical modification of the classic Whipple procedure, offering insights that can enhance surgical exposure and potentially improve outcomes for patients with pancreatic cancer. Through these focused contributions, Dr. Goglia has established himself as a thoughtful voice in the ongoing effort to make complex cancer surgeries safer and more effective.
